Chlorine in PDB 1zt1: Crystal Structure of Class I Mhc H-2KK in Complex with An OctapeptideProtein crystallography data
The structure of Crystal Structure of Class I Mhc H-2KK in Complex with An Octapeptide, PDB code: 1zt1
was solved by
C.Kellenberger,
A.Roussel,
B.Malissen,
with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:
Chlorine Binding Sites:
The binding sites of Chlorine atom in the Crystal Structure of Class I Mhc H-2KK in Complex with An Octapeptide
(pdb code 1zt1). This binding sites where shown within
5.0 Angstroms radius around Chlorine atom.
